First off, let's understand what a Waterproof Cement Sandwich Board is. It's a composite panel made up of a core material sandwiched between two layers of cement-based facings. The core material can vary, but commonly it's something like expanded polystyrene (EPS), which has good insulation qualities right off the bat.

How does it insulate?

The insulation property of a Waterproof Cement Sandwich Board mainly comes from its core material. In the case of EPS core boards, EPS is a lightweight, rigid foam plastic. It's filled with millions of tiny air pockets. Air is a poor conductor of heat, which means it doesn't transfer heat easily. So, when these air - filled pockets are packed together in the EPS core, they create a barrier that slows down the transfer of heat.

Let's talk about heat transfer for a sec. There are three main ways heat can move: conduction, convection, and radiation.

Conduction: This is when heat moves through a solid material. In a Waterproof Cement Sandwich Board, the EPS core with its air pockets disrupts the path of heat conduction. The cement facings also play a role. They are relatively dense compared to the EPS core, but they are designed to work in tandem with the core. The cement layers add structural strength and also act as an additional barrier to heat conduction.

Convection: Convection is the transfer of heat through the movement of fluids (liquids or gases). The closed - cell structure of the EPS core prevents air from moving freely within it. This means there's no large - scale convection current that can carry heat through the board. So, the heat transfer due to convection is minimized.

Radiation: Heat can also be transferred in the form of electromagnetic waves. While the EPS core itself doesn't do much to block radiation directly, the cement facings can absorb and reflect some of the radiant heat. Some advanced Waterproof Cement Sandwich Boards may also have special coatings on the cement facings to enhance their ability to reflect radiant heat.

Factors affecting insulation

There are a few factors that can affect how well a Waterproof Cement Sandwich Board insulates.

Thickness: It's pretty straightforward - the thicker the board, the better the insulation. A thicker core means more air pockets and a longer path for heat to travel through, which increases the board's thermal resistance.

Density of the core material: If the EPS core has a higher density, it may have fewer air pockets, which can reduce its insulation effectiveness. On the other hand, if it's too low in density, it may not provide enough structural support. So, there's a sweet spot for density that manufacturers aim for to balance insulation and strength.

Quality of the cement facings: The quality of the cement used in the facings matters. High - quality cement can provide better protection against heat transfer and also be more durable. Some cement facings may have additives that improve their thermal properties.

Benefits of using Waterproof Cement Sandwich Boards for insulation

Energy efficiency: By reducing heat transfer, these boards can help keep buildings cooler in the summer and warmer in the winter. This means less energy is needed for heating and cooling systems, which can lead to significant cost savings over time.

Moisture resistance: The "waterproof" part of the name is crucial. Moisture can degrade insulation materials over time. Since these boards are waterproof, the insulation properties remain stable even in humid or wet conditions.

Easy installation: Waterproof Cement Sandwich Boards are relatively easy to install. They come in pre - fabricated panels, which can save a lot of time and labor during construction.
